Why These Are the Top Hyundai Repair Auto Repair Shops in Lowell

** The Hyundai repair market for Lowell residents is almost entirely externalized to Eugene and Springfield. For **warranty work, recall campaigns (especially critical for Theta II engines), and hybrid/EV systems**, the dealership (**Kendall Hyundai of Eugene**) is the essential and often only compliant option. It commands higher labor rates but offers factory-backed guarantees and specialized equipment. The independent shop market in Eugene/Springfield is robust and competitive, with several highly-rated shops (like C&M Auto and All Import) offering deep technical expertise on Hyundai's complex mechanical systems (GDI, DCT, turbos) at more competitive labor rates. These shops thrive by building trust and specializing in the repairs that dealerships often charge a premium for. For Lowell residents, the choice typically hinges on the repair type: warranty/recall = dealership; advanced mechanical repair = a trusted independent specialist. Average labor rates in the area range from $130-$165/hour at independents to $165-$195/hour at the dealership.

What are the most common Hyundai repair issues for drivers in the Lowell, Oregon area?

Given our local climate with wet winters and forested roads, common issues include premature brake wear, electrical problems from moisture, and suspension wear from rural road conditions. Specific Hyundai models, like the Santa Fe and Sonata, often require attention for steering column noises and engine theta II issues, which local specialists are familiar with.

How can I find a reputable Hyundai repair shop near Lowell?

Look for shops in Lowell or nearby Oakridge that are ASE-certified and have specific experience with Hyundai/Kia vehicles. Checking for online reviews from other local drivers and asking if they use genuine or OEM-quality parts are good indicators of a quality shop suited to our area's driving needs.

When should I seek local service for a check engine light on my Hyundai?

Seek service immediately if the light is flashing or if you notice a loss of power, as this could indicate a serious issue. For a steady light, it's best to have a local technician in Lowell diagnose it promptly, as delayed repairs on modern Hyundais can lead to more costly damage, especially before mountain or winter driving.

What local driving conditions in Lowell should influence my Hyundai's maintenance schedule?

The damp, rainy weather and hilly, often graveled rural roads around Lowell and Dexter Reservoir increase wear on brakes, tires, and undercarriage components. It's advisable to have your Hyundai's brakes and suspension inspected more frequently than the manual suggests and to ensure all-weather tires are in good condition for year-round safety.
